One suspect has been arrested by the Ghana Police Service after a group of armed robbers abandoned their vehicle during a failed robbery operation in Accra. The robbers were so compelled to flee that they left behind highly relevant evidence, such as weapons and their getaway vehicle. Since then, the police have launched a manhunt for the remaining suspects in the botched operation.

Arrest made after failed robbery

The armed robbers tried to carry out a robbery in a residential area in the early hours of the day. But the operation did not run according to plan and when the robbers were unable to get away from the car, they got out and ran off on foot.

GhanaWeb reports that one suspect was arrested with firearms and other tools used in the attempted robbery, and that quick police intervention was responsible. He is in police custody and cooperating with police probe into criminal gang’s activities.

Weapons found at the scene

During the operation police found weapons, including firearms, ammunition and other tools that were believed to have been taken to be used in break-ins, in the abandoned vehicle. These weapons have let investigators trace other gang member movements and identities through finding them.

The police said: ‘We have commended the quick action of the local authorities who swiftly arrested a suspect and seized dangerous weapons that may have been used in future crimes.’ Now, the authorities are gathering the evidence they’ve gathered in order to find the other suspects who escaped.

Ongoing manhunt for suspects

The Ghana Police Service has intensified its search for the other robbers who were involved in the failed heist after the arrest. The public is being asked to provide any information that could help law enforcement agencies locate the remaining members of the gang. The police has asked for residents in the affected areas to be vigilant and report any suspicious activities in order to aid the search for the robbers.

Authorities believe the remaining suspects are still at large and could try to elude capture. But the police are confident the public and ongoing investigations will result in the arrest of the whole gang.
